C Battery, 5th Battalion, 16th Artillery was a key unit of the 4th Infantry Division during the Vietnam War. Activated in the 1960s, the battery provided direct and general support artillery fire, primarily using 155mm howitzers. Deployed to Vietnam, C Battery participated in major operations such as the Central Highlands campaigns and the battles around Pleiku and Dak To, delivering crucial fire support to infantry units. The unit earned commendations for its professionalism and effectiveness under challenging combat conditions before its redeployment and eventual inactivation following the U.S. withdrawal from Vietnam.
